public HolidayInfoModel GetHolidays(string companyCode, string Region_Code) { HolidayInfoModel objholiday = null; List <Holiday> lstregionholiday = null; List <Holiday> lstholidayyear = null; try { using (IDbConnection connection = IDbOpenConnection()) { var p = new DynamicParameters(); p.Add("@Company_Code", companyCode); p.Add("@Region_Code", Region_Code); using (var multiselect = connection.QueryMultiple(SP_HD_GetHolidaysforRegion, p, commandType: CommandType.StoredProcedure)) { lstregionholiday = multiselect.Read <Holiday>().ToList(); lstholidayyear = multiselect.Read <Holiday>().ToList(); } objholiday = new HolidayInfoModel(); objholiday.lstregionholiday = lstregionholiday; objholiday.lstholidayyear = lstholidayyear; connection.Close(); } } catch (Exception ex) { throw; } return(objholiday); }
public HolidayInfoModel GetHolidays(string companyCode, string Region_Code) { HolidayInfoModel lstregionholiday = null; try { DAL_RegionCreation _objDal = new DAL_RegionCreation(); lstregionholiday = _objDal.GetHolidays(companyCode, Region_Code); } catch (Exception ex) { throw; } return(lstregionholiday); }
public JsonResult GetHolidays(string RegionCode) { string companyCode = null; HolidayInfoModel lstholidays = null; try { _objCurrInfo = new CurrentInfo(); companyCode = _objCurrInfo.GetCompanyCode(); lstholidays = _objbl.GetHolidays(companyCode, RegionCode); return(Json(lstholidays, JsonRequestBehavior.AllowGet)); } catch (Exception ex) { throw; } }